Spreading Holiday Magic At East Islip High School
East Islip HS students from the STARS club, National Honor Society and varsity softball team teamed up with local nonprofit Christmas Magic.
From East Islip School District: East Islip High School students from the STARS club, National Honor Society and varsity softball team teamed up with local nonprofit Christmas Magic this holiday season, spreading cheer and acting as Santaβs personal shoppers for kids in need on Long Island. After shopping for the presents, purchased with donations from Christmas Magic, the students wrapped the gifts with care.
βIt was a good feeling knowing that these kids will wake up to a bunch of presents that we helped pick out and wrap,β said softball team captain Katie Burk, whose teamβs efforts were for children at a Middle Island shelter.
